Economy & Jobs

McMullen residents earn a median household income of $12,083 , which is 84%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$15,415. The unemployment rate stands at 15.0% (317% above the U.S. rate of 3.6%). The area is home to 398 business establishments, including 15 restaurants.

Safety & Crime

McMullen reports 416 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 10% above the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,789/100K.

Education

0.0% of adults in McMullen hold a bachelor's degree or higher (100% below the national average). 15.0% have completed high school. Local schools score 4.0/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

McMullen has an average annual temperature of 63°F (17°C). Winters average 44°F in January while summers reach 81°F in July. The area gets 323 sunny days per year.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 41.
